Play design by Shanahan is so creative and a joy to watch..... fits their personal to the tee..... he stumbled a few times with clock management early in the year but his in your face play calling (all run no pass) really exposes and demoralizes defenses when they can't stop it...... its like game over and everyone knows it.....

If you have watched the 9rs all year, they can pass, not world class, but better than average..... allow for one or two bozo throws by Jimmy G a game, but net net, he can get the job done...... just look at his record.....

Finally, and the reason I am more confident that I probably should be about the 9rs in this game (and as a team) is they absolute control the line of scrimmage on both sides.....O and D..... that wins championships.....

Their D line and run blocking is old school which in a way is fun to watch for a change after all these Offense driven teams

IF there is an achilles heel, it may be stopping a scrambling quarterback, that's the wild card with KC/Mahomes.... they absolutely smash up pocket quarterbacks but can struggle stopping runners.... J. Winston (W1 of 2), K. Murray (W2 of 2), L. Jackson (W0/1), R. Wilson (W1 of 2).... so, basically should be a great game.
